Get in touch with us nowIn Panama, the corruption perception index score increased from 35 points in 2020 to 36 points in 2021, the same score reported in 2019. Overall, the score had remained stable between 33 and 39 points since 2012. The worst possible score in perception of corruption is 0, whereas a score of 100 indicates that no corruption is perceived in the respective country.
This index is a composite indicator that includes data on the perception of corruption in areas such as bribery of public officials, kickbacks in public procurement, embezzlement of state funds, and effectiveness of governments' anti-corruption efforts.
